Scrapbooking Paper Frames

Scrapbooking paper comes in different shapes, sizes, and types, so you can choose the one that best fits your individual personality or memory.  Card stock is one of the most often used papers in scrapbooking.  One of the heavier scrapbooking papers is card stock.  High quality card stock comes in various colors and is usually solidly colored.  If the paper is high quality scrapbook paper, it will have a white core.  That means that if you were to tear the paper in half you would see a white line between the two layers of color.  If you are looking for card stock with a delicate texture pattern, it is available.

In scrapbooking papers, you also have to remember your patterned papers.  There is a wide variety of great patterns you can choose from today.  A lot of patterned scrapbooking papers have different patterns on either side, to give you more variety and a chance  to use your creativity in pairing different patterns for less money.  Your memory page can be imbued with spirit and energy by using patterned scrapbook.

What should you consider when purchasing paper?

One of the most important things in a scrapbook is the paper, so you need to purchase some that is high quality.  Your photos, naturally, are your most important supply; however, pairing these photos with just the right paper can improve your scrapbook significantly.  Choosing acid and lignin free scrapbooking paper will prevent the discoloration that often occurs over time.

Digital Scrapbook Layouts To Preserve Your Memories

Digital scrapbooking is catching on fast. You can use your computer and make unique digital scrapbook pages. You can remove red eye, crop pictures, touch up colors, brighten, sharpen, and perform other functions with photo editing programs and make your photos beautiful and more fun!
The subject of a photo should suggest the kinds of sayings and decor that would work well on a digital scrapbook page. Using the text tool in your editing program, you can add location and date information to the image.

When working on birthday pages on your digital scrapbook you can add a cake, candles and even the persons age if you like. Christmas trees that include the year that the Christmas pictures were taken make nice accents. Many holiday themes are available online allowing accents for other holidays. A great background idea for graduation pictures is to add in caps and gowns along with the graduation year. Adding special effects to your computer scrapbook pages can be done in countless ways!

One great option with digital scrapbooking is the ability to print more than one copy of your page. This is great for making albums for everyone in your family or on your Christmas list. Many different varieties of textures and paper designs as well as ink can be used. You can even print pages in 12′ x 12′ size if you own a printer that can print in wide format. Most regular printers though do 8” x 8” well. Printouts of your digital scrapbook pages, compiled in an album or coffee-table book, provide instant gratification.

On doing digital scrapbook pages there are several other benefits. If you make a mistake laying out one of these pages all you do is click undo and do it over again, you can keep doing this as many times as it takes to get it right. It is less messy doing digital scrapbooking too. Instead of dealing with cutting and pasting paper, or using your own handwriting on your pages, you can simply print your pages, and add personal touches as you like. All of your pictures can be handily kept on your computer or on a CD-R or DVD-R.
